Tour Overview

osaka-must-see-area-shinsekai-90-minutes-guided-tour

The 90-minute guided tour of Shinsekai, Osaka provides visitors with an immersive exploration of this vibrant area.

The tour is accessible to wheelchair users and available in both Japanese and English. Guests can opt for a private group experience.

The tour starts at Ebisucho Station and ends at Dobutsuen-mae Station, showcasing the iconic Tsutenkaku Tower, Janjan Yokocho Alley, and Shinsekai Market.

Along the way, the local expert guide offers cultural insights and highlights must-see locations, ensuring first-time visitors have a comprehensive understanding of Shinsekai’s history as an entertainment district.

Janjan Yokocho Alley

osaka-must-see-area-shinsekai-90-minutes-guided-tour

Leaving the iconic Tsutenkaku Tower behind, the tour leads visitors into the narrow alleyways of Janjan Yokocho. This 1960s-style retro arcade offers a glimpse into Osaka’s nostalgic past. Guests will wander through a maze of quaint shops, bars, and dining establishments, each one exuding a unique character.

Biliken

osaka-must-see-area-shinsekai-90-minutes-guided-tour

After exploring the bustling Shinsekai Market, the tour then leads visitors to the famous Biliken statue.

Biliken is a lucky charm figure with a jolly, smiling face and oversized feet. Rubbing Biliken’s feet is believed to bring good fortune.

The guide explains the statue’s history and significance as a symbol of happiness and prosperity. Tourists eagerly line up to rub Biliken’s feet, hoping to receive a bit of his luck.

The Biliken experience offers a unique cultural interaction and photo opportunity, providing insight into the superstitions and traditions that are deeply woven into Osaka’s vibrant Shinsekai district.
